Meghna Reddy

Last updated

Meghna Reddy (born 24 October 1975) is an Indian VJ and super model from Andhra Pradesh. [1] She started as a VJ for Channel V and one of her first shows was Mangta Hai.

Early life

Reddy was born in Rajahmundry, Andhra Pradesh [2] but was raised in Bombay (now Mumbai) by her Telugu father, Chintapoli Reddy, a businessman, and a Mangalorean Konkani mother. [3] [4] Her mother Nakshatra, referred to as Niki by her daughters and the media, was a microbiologist and worked with an NGO. [5] She has two sisters, [6] Sushama Reddy, a former Indian actress is the eldest, [7] and the youngest, Sameera Reddy, is a Bollywood actress and model. [8] [9] On 12 December 2008, Reddy was married in Greece to Ariel Mionis, a Greek businessman, whom she describes as an artist, a published poet, photographer and painter. [10]

Career

Reddy is a former VJ who co-anchored the show Mangta Hai, on Channel V during the mid-nineties. After a VJ career for many years she left for England for better opportunities. Currently, she lives in New York and models for mail catalogs such as Macy's. She made her debut in the New York fashion scene in September 2002, walking the ramp for designer Diane von Furstenberg. [11] She was cast in 2003 Bollywood erotic thriller Boom (film) which she left midway and was replaced by Katrina Kaif. [12] She was also featured on the National Geographic cover in August 1999 with an article in the Global Culture section. [1]
